Output ecdd0fa004505389241689987ed904bfee64a5dcdb35107a2a65c1c6e1604cd3:23

value
272222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d903b3b4cf5188b22b29e844caf63ac46cef1e9 OP_EQUAL
address
35qw7YiYD385ZUksra7A6JSZtbFMsqW1Jq
transaction
ecdd0fa004505389241689987ed904bfee64a5dcdb35107a2a65c1c6e1604cd3
spent
true